MAINSTAGE PRODUCTIONS: The musical theatre department season of performances will include three Main stage, fully produced shows per year, each with an average 3 months rehearsal process and at least one full weekend of performances. Rehearsals will be every Friday afternoon and Saturday morning/afternoon, and occasional evenings and Sunday rehearsals as needed for lead characters and Tech week. The majority of these shows are performed offsite at a professional theatre.

NOTE: In addition to MAINSTAGE PRODUCTIONS, musical theatre students will have many chances to showcase their talents in other various performance opportunities, such as: our yearly themed “Recital,” periodic vocal “showcases,” and small scale studio plays.
